From: John Millikin <john@john-millikin.com>

SunOS expects CD-ROM devices to have a block size of 512, and will
fail to mount or install using QEMU's default block size of 2048.

When initializing the SCSI device, allow the `physical_block_size'
block device option to override the default block size.
